Аннотация

This article examines the methodological foundations of organizing the educational process for pre-service
teachers based on a competency-based approach. It highlights the principles, structural components, and pedagogical
strategies required for developing both professional and key competencies in teacher education. The paper proposes a
competency-oriented instructional model that integrates theoretical knowledge, practical skills, and reflective experience.
It further outlines the expected outcomes of implementing this approach in teacher training institutions
